Following the army of unseen workers who keep one of London's busiest shopping streets moving. Going undercover with police officers hunting for shoplifters, Tube staff coping with rush hour, and the retailers who compete to entice visitors in.
2003
2023
2024
2018
1990
2013
2022
2017
1972
1999
2007
2008